AXIOS (Avery Lotz) - Supreme Court allows Trump's ballroom construction to proceed for now

The Supreme Court ruled Friday that President Trump's sprawling ballroom project can proceed for now, despite a lower court's ruling that halted the administration's plans. Why it matters: The decision is a major win for the administration, which has argued that demolishing the White House's East Wing and building the ballroom are necessary for security. WASHINGTONPOST (Violet Jira) - White House space policy aims for 1,000 launches a year by 2030

A new space transportation policy from the Trump administration calls for a dramatic increase in launches, as well as working with the commercial space industry to send humans to Mars.

JUSTTHENEWS (Kevin Killough) - Zuckerberg buys 19th Century castle in Ireland estimated to cost between $23 million and $35 million

Strancally Castle was built around 1830 on land overlooking the River Blackwater. It's located about 125 miles from Meta's European headquarters.
